چکیده مقاله:

The stability assessment of soil slopes remains a fundamental challenge in geotechnical engineering. This study employs Artificial Neural Networks (ANN) to predict the stability of roadside soil slopes. A representative slope configuration was defined using six key geotechnical parameters: unit weight, cohesion, friction angle, Poisson's ratio, Young's modulus, and slope angle, as input variables. A comprehensive parametric analysis was conducted using Finite Element Analysis (FEA) to compute the Factor of Safety (FS) across ۴,۰۰۰ distinct parameter combinations, resulting in a robust and high-fidelity dataset. Two distinct ANN architectures were developed: the first model is trained to predict the FS, while the second model estimates the slope angle. The results demonstrate that the models effectively capture the complex, nonlinear relationship between soil properties and slope stability with reasonable accuracy. The ANN models were rigorously validated using two empirical case studies, exhibiting strong concordance between model predictions and observed field performance. The findings substantiate the efficacy of ANN based methodologies as a reliable computational tool for slope stability evaluation, facilitating rapid, accurate, and providing rapid, accurate, and efficient support for geotechnical design optimization and risk mitigation.
